Ms. Lindi Yeni has been in Houston for over 38 years.
She then discovered her niche while at Shape Community
Center and started one of the nations first and only
existing Theatres with specialty of African dance- The
World famous Kuumba House Performance Theatre. Influencing
others throughout the country. Born out of this Theatre
hundreds of production companies; theatres; dance companies
and performers were able to get their start; training;
development for success. More are in the wings.
Ms. Lindi Yeni was so compelled with what Oprah Winfrey;
Madonna; Angelina Jolie; Bono; and others were doing
in her homeland and knew she had to go back to help
because the needs were so great and intense. She even
created a production to make Americans aware of the
AIDS epidemic and she honored Rockets - Mr. Dikembe
for his works in Africa and Hosted Winnie Mandela and
Performed for Pres. Nelson Mandela.
Ms. Lindi Yeni stepped down from her duties of Executive
Artistic Director after almost 27 years to complete
her Bachelors of Science Degree in Biblical Studies
and Counseling on April 26th, 2008. The following day
she closed out the stage with her final public performance
in the United States at the Houston International Festival,
appropriately celebrating- "Out of Africa".
The crowd gave her a standing ovation.
